What are Composite Doors?
Composite doors are crafted to integrate the very best functions of different materials, such as wood, uPVC, and fiberglass. The core of a composite Door Installation Contractor generally features a strong laminate or foam core, ensuring exceptional thermal insulation and security. This makes them an appealing choice for house owners looking to boost both energy performance and curb appeal.

Key Components of Composite Doors
Composite doors are made up of several layers, that include:
- Outer Skin: Usually made from GRP (Glass Reinforced Plastic) or uPVC, this layer adds to the door's durability and low upkeep requirements.
- Core Material: The core supplies structural strength and insulation. Alternatives include strong wood, plywood, or energy-efficient foam.
- Insulation Layer: This layer boosts thermal efficiency, keeping homes warmer throughout winter season and cooler in summer season.
- Frame: The frame is typically reinforced to make sure strength and stability, contributing to the total security of the Professional Door Installer.

Frequently Asked Questions about Residential Composite Doors
1. Are composite doors more costly than standard wooden doors?
Yes, composite doors tend to have a greater preliminary cost compared to conventional wood doors. However, their resilience and low upkeep costs can make them more cost-effective in the long run.
2. How do I keep my composite door?
Upkeep is minimal. An easy wash with warm soapy water and a soft fabric is generally adequate to keep the door looking great. Prevent abrasive products or harsh chemicals that can damage the surface area.
3. Can composite doors be painted?
While Composite Door Installer doors are created to keep their surface, they can be painted if desired. Nevertheless, it is advisable to utilize high-quality exterior paint and follow maker's standards guarantee longevity.
4. Are composite doors energy efficient?
Yes, composite doors are understood for their exceptional thermal insulation properties. They can substantially decrease energy costs by keeping heat inside throughout winter and blocking outside warmth throughout summertime.
5. What should I look for in regards to service warranty?
Numerous makers provide warranties varying from 5 to 20 years. It's vital to ascertain what is covered under the service warranty and whether it consists of problems associated with product flaws and fading.
